Output 62b561a179e554adc0dc0796b7cf8b2b4f49aef251c15b48b6fbd185616db068:1

value
31003520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ab307aec0e98e5caf4216fbe75e44b7fd993d23 OP_EQUAL
address
373PatkfSzPnw5o6qZsR1ZhbNUtZz9o74U
transaction
62b561a179e554adc0dc0796b7cf8b2b4f49aef251c15b48b6fbd185616db068
spent
true